Abstract

Acylation of aromatic compounds with carboxylic acids smoothly proceeded at 190–230° C in the presence of zeolite catalysts under microwave irradiation to give aromatic ketones efficiently. H–Y (SiO2/Al2O3= 30–80) and H–beta (25) zeolites were active for the acylation reaction, giving the aromatic ketones in good yields. Carboxylic acids such as hexanoic and butyric acid smoothly underwent the acylation, while propionic acid showed somewhat ...
